The Dream Coach

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

First edition, 1924

The Dream Coach is a 1924 children's fantasy book written and illustrated by siblings Anne and Dillwyn Parrish. It is a collection of four fairytale-like stories linked by the theme of a Dream Coach, which travels around the world bringing dreams to children.[1] The book earned a Newbery Honor in 1925.[2]

Stories

[edit]
  • The Seven White Dreams of the King's Daughter
  • Goran's Dream
  • A Bird Cage With Tassels of Purple and Pearls (Three Dreams of a Little Chinese Emperor)
  • King Philippe's Dream
